Free analogues of Compass 3D

One of the best in design automation paid systems– Compass-3. There are three versions of this program available to users: the “Compass-3D” itself, the “Compass-3D Home” and “Compass-3D LT” systems.

The Compass system is not cheap, so by installing a similar free program, your savings reach 93,000 rubles.

DraftSight

DraftSight – does not require any fees, just register and that’s it.

In fact, this planar design system duplicates AutoCAD. Can work with files with the DWG extension of any version. Program settings are available in a wide range.

Among the languages ​​of the package there is Russian. The interface will not cause any inconvenience, and the program's capabilities are impressive.

There is a distribution for almost any existing operating system

CADE

A good program for editing diagrams is CADE. It is completely free, but its main purpose is to design network diagrams. Compatible with formats: dbr, pdf, jpeg, shp, dwg, dgn, dxf, dts. Mapping capability and UML support included.

LibreCAD

Another system for working in 2D is the free LibreCAD. This system runs on Windows, Linux and MacOS X. Its functionality contains many tools: polygons, arcs, lines, circles. There are many modifiers. The interface will not be surprising - it is standard.

FreeCAD

FreeCAD is a free CAD system that works with 3D models. Multiplatform. The program is good for use in engineering work for design and technical design. Can create models for printing on a 3D printer, thanks to support for the STL format.

It is compatible with SVG formats(Scalable Vector Graphics), DXF, OBJ (Wavefront), STEP, IGES, STL (STereoLithography), DAE (Collada), IV (Inventor), SCAD (OpenSCAD) and IFC. In addition, FreeCAD uses its own formats.

A9Tech

Another free analogue Compass-3 – A9Tech. Works in its own formats. The program elements are standard, it is possible to create drawings. A9Tech supports layer-by-layer work in the drawing, allowing you to spend less effort on work.

QCAD

You need free program to create complex 2D drawings and plans? The main purpose of QCAD is to help architects and mechanical engineers draw. Its CAD collection reaches more than 4,700 finished parts. The main problem with this system is the lack of compatibility with files in the DWG format. Only DXF format is supported. You can draw arcs, ellipses, circles, points, straight lines and other elements.

QCAD functionality will enable the designer necessary tools to create and modify plans and drawings. The kit includes 35 fonts needed for CAD. Unlike others free systems design has the ability to print to scale. Additional process control is provided command line located at the bottom of the main QCAD window. The interface is not complicated, it is understandable at the level of intuition. System requirements They are pleased with their low level.

BRL-CAD

BRL-CAD is another one of the free CAD products. This cross-platform program is capable of working with three-dimensional objects using an interactive geometry editor. This powerful application has been in development for over 20 years. The main disadvantage is that it is quite difficult to understand.

KOMPAS-3D capabilities for mechanical engineering and instrument making

The design of machine-building and instrument-making products imposes high demands on the tools used. KOMPAS-3D meets the most modern requirements. The system's capabilities ensure the design of mechanical engineering products of any complexity and in accordance with the most advanced design methods. The system contains tools for working using the “top-down” or top-down design method, as well as using the already familiar “bottom-up” method.


Classic solid modeling

KOMPAS-3D allows you to work on various parts and assemblies using solid modeling, which is perfect for designing various shafts, bushings, brackets and housings different configurations. The basic commands here are extrusion and rotation operations.


Creating sheet metal parts and shells

For mechanical engineering and instrument making, a typical task is the design and subsequent production of sheet metal products. KOMPAS-3D contains a rich toolkit for designing such parts, allowing you to create the most complex structures from sheet metal, followed by automatic development of the designed parts. When designing sheet metal parts and shells, it will be easy to create parts using:

  • shells,
  • folds,
  • cutting,
  • cutouts,
  • elements of open and closed stamping,
  • blinds and collars.


Design with complex surfaces

When designing parts with complex geometry, the surface modeling functionality will be useful. Similar problems are encountered when designing blades and when designing instrument bodies that are made of plastic. The use of surface modeling will make it possible to obtain parts of various shapes and thereby meet the requirements put forward for these products - be it streamlining or ergonomics. There are many options for constructing complex surfaces:

  • by squeezing out
  • rotation,
  • kinematic operation,
  • by sections,
  • by points,
  • along a layer of points,
  • along a network of curves.

Formation of an electronic model of products

When designing in KOMPAS-3D, you receive an electronic model that may contain the data necessary for the manufacture and subsequent life stages of your product. A model created in KOMPAS-3D can already contain:

  • properties and name of the material,
  • dimensions taking into account tolerance,
  • technical requirements,
  • roughness,
  • form tolerances,
  • base designation,
  • designation of places of branding and marking.

Moreover, you can receive documentation for such a product automatically. The specification is generated based on the 3D model of the assembly unit, and the creation of drawings will consist of placing associative views from the 3D model on the drawing format.
